Timing Belt

I was looking at the procedures for replacing the timing belt on on my 86NT.
Do I really have to take the rocker cover off and loosen the cam in order to get the job done. That would involve a lot more work with the addition of more gaskets and time since the intake has to come off. Which is a real pain in the A**/Butt.

Re: Timing Belt

I know it has been several months since this was posted, but I did my old 85 Z31's belt without messing with the rockers. It took a few tries to get it in time, but I still see it driving around town from time to time and I changed the belt about a year ago. It ran fine when I sold it.
